Identification and Creation

Object Number
2021.366
People
Michael Sweerts, Flemish (Brussels 1618 - 1664 Goa, India)
Title
Portrait of a Man
Classification
Prints
Work Type
print
Date
17th century
Culture
Flemish
Persistent Link
https://hvrd.art/o/370332

Physical Descriptions

Medium
Etching on off-white antique laid paper
Technique
Etching
Dimensions
sheet: 20.7 × 16.3 cm (8 1/8 × 6 7/16 in.)
Inscriptions and Marks
  • inscription: in plate, lower left: Ca. Michael Sweerts Pi. et fe.
  • inscription: verso, lower left, graphite: 2[or Z] 4530
  • inscription: lower right, graphite, erased: [illegible]
  • inscription: verso, lower left, graphite, erased: [illegible]

Provenance

Recorded Ownership History
[R. E. Lewis, Inc. Original Prints and Drawings, Larkspur Landing, CA], sold; Arthur K. and Mariot F. Solomon, Cambridge, bequest; to Harvard Art Museums, 2021

State, Edition, Standard Reference Number

State
only state
Standard Reference Number
Hollstein 20; Bartsch IV.417.5
